• Active Senior Citizens of Standish: Meet second and fourth Wednesdays of the month at the Steep Falls Fire Barn on Boundary Road. FMI or for luncheon reservations contact Alvida Fogg at 642-4929 or June Frost at 727-6215.

• Book Club at Steep Falls Library is held at 11 a.m. on the second Wednesday each month. Please bring your own brown-bag lunch. FMI 675-3147.

• Meal Sites are at the Steep Falls Fire Barn on the second and fourth Wednesdays. Reservations for meals must be made before 9:30 a.m on the Monday before each meeting. FMI contact Alvida Fogg at 642-4929 or June Frost at 727-6215. Meals: $3.

• Seniors Wednesday Brunch is a community project sponsored by the Sebago Lake Congregational Church (Route 35 at Sebago Lake Village). The Brunches are the first Wednesday of the month from 9:30-11 a.m. FMI contact John Murphy at 839-6002. Meals: $4 donation.

• Friday Luncheons sponsored by Southern Maine Agency on Aging. Meets third Friday of each month at Sebago Lake Congregational Church. Friday Luncheons are the first Friday of the month at 11 a.m. FMI call 1-800-400-6325. Meals: $4.
